Gaining Insight into Python Syntax

Python syntax is lauded for its similarity to plain English, making it a beginner-friendly language. In this part, we’ll delve into key syntax components like indentation, variables, data types, operators, and comments.

Indentation

Unlike other languages that utilize brackets to define code blocks, Python relies on indentation. Consistency in indentation is critical as it determines the structure of code blocks.

Variables

In the Python language, variables require no explicit declaration before use. A variable is created simply by assigning a value to it. Notably, Python is dynamically typed which means the variable’s type can change as the program progresses.

Data Types

Python houses various data types such as integers, floating-point numbers, strings, lists, tuples, and dictionaries. Comprehension of each of these is key to manipulating data in your programs.

Operators

Operators in Python encompass arithmetic, comparison, assignment, logical, membership, and identity operators. These are essential for formulating logic and performing calculations.

Comments

Comments are integral for elucidating and documenting your code. In Python, comments commence with a #, and anything subsequent to that on the line is disregarded by the interpreter.

Control Constructs and Functions

To engineer more complex programs, understanding control structures like if statements, for loops, while loops, and functions is necessary.

If Statements

If statements offer a method to execute code based on a condition. Python supports basic if, else, and elif (else if) constructs.

Loops

For loops enable iteration over a sequence, while while loops run until a condition remains true.

Functions

Functions represent blocks of reusable code that carry out a specific task. In Python, a function is defined using the def keyword and is called by writing the function name followed by parentheses.

Engaging With Data Structures

Python offers a variety of built-in data structures such as lists, tuples, sets, and dictionaries. Each has its distinct properties and use cases.

Lists

Lists are mutable sequences, typically used to store collections of homogeneous items. They are formed by placing comma-separated values inside square brackets.

Tuples

Tuples are immutable and typically used to store heterogeneous data. They are formed by placing comma-separated values inside parentheses.

Sets

Sets represent unordered collections of unique elements and are formed by values separated by commas inside curly braces.

Dictionaries

Dictionaries are unordered, mutable collections of key-value pairs. Keys must be unique and hashable. Dictionaries are created by placing comma-separated key:value pairs inside curly braces.

Managing Files in Python

Python simplifies reading from and writing to files. Whether it’s text files or binary files, Python has built-in functions like open(), read(), write(), and close() that efficiently manage file operations.

Modules and Packages

The true prowess of Python lies in modules and packages, facilitating modular programming and code reusability.

Modules

A module is a single Python file that can encompass functions, classes, or variables. Incorporating a module into your code is effortless using the import statement.

Packages

Packages are namespaces containing multiple modules. They provide a hierarchical framework for organizing your Python code.

Error Handling

Exceptional programs need to manage unexpected errors gracefully. Python’s try-exception construct is employed to catch and handle exceptions, ensuring your program doesn’t crash when encountering unforeseen issues.

Object-Oriented Programming (OOP)

Python is an object-oriented language. It enables the definition of classes, creation of objects, and encapsulation of data and functions together.

Classes and Objects

A class acts as a blueprint for creating objects, providing initial values for state (attributes) and implementations of behavior (methods).

Inheritance

Inheritance forms new classes using classes that have already been defined. It promotes code reuse and creates a natural hierarchy.

Polymorphism and Encapsulation

Polymorphism allows the use of a unified interface with an ability to implement different behaviors. Encapsulation involves bundling the data and the methods that operate on the data within one unit.
